Transaction 40ab3338638d40e41e7bdbc7b3cc3ebeef37f31c0bc5aded268196d2eb8fe160

2 Input
2 Outputs
  • 40ab3338638d40e41e7bdbc7b3cc3ebeef37f31c0bc5aded268196d2eb8fe160:0
  • value  70052
    address  16xdezzdeTQghh2jWytQxLhZxFUGW4ZVmi
  • 40ab3338638d40e41e7bdbc7b3cc3ebeef37f31c0bc5aded268196d2eb8fe160:1
  • value  26460000
    address  3AmMCKvNABhch6KhwgyGy5V7N5Cbsa6m2h